If you are a lazy person who don’t like to read much yet want a piece of Saigon on a daily basis, this Vietnam blogger is one to follow. What this fellow does is he uploads 1 picture of Ho Chi Minh City, Saigon, everyday. He rarely writes and if he does, they are never more than 50 words. What this Vietnam blogger relies on are the titles which are always aptly applied to those Saigon pictures. Some examples below:
